What's The Definition Of Cursed?
[adj] deserving a curse; sometimes used as an intensifier; "villagers shun the area believing it to be cursed"; "cursed with four daughter"; "not a cursed drop"; "his cursed stupidity"; "I'll be cursed if I can see your reasoning"
[adj] (Christianity) in danger of the eternal punishment of hell; "poor damned souls" Synonyms | Synonyms for Cursed: accursed | accurst | blame | blamed | blasted | blessed | cursed with(p) | curst | damn | damnable | damned | darned | deuced | doomed | everlasting | execrable | goddam | goddamn | goddamned | infernal | lost | maledict | stuck with(p) | unredeemed | unsaved Related Terms | Find terms related to Cursed: accursed | blankety-blank | blasted | blessed | confounded | cussed | damn | damnable | damned | demoniac | demonic | devilish | diabolic | disgusting | doggone | execrable | fiendish | ghoulish | goddamn | goddamned | hateful | hellish | infernal | odious | satanic | ungodly See Also | Cursed In Webster's Dictionary \Curs"ed\ (k?rs"?d), a.
Deserving a curse; execrable; hateful; detestable;
abominable.
Let us fly this cursed place. --Milton.
This cursed quarrel be no more renewed. --Dryden.
